在上面的配置中,我们通过ConfigMap设置了Nacos服务的地址、端口、命名空间以及访问密钥等信息。在部署应用程序时,我们可以将这些配置注入到Pod中,让应用程序能够正确连接到Nacos服务。 通过以上步骤的操作,我们可以解决"nacos authorization failed"的错误,确保微服务应用程序能够正常连接和使用Nacos服务。希望以上内容能够帮助...
用户尝试执行写操作(action='w'),但read只授予了只读权限; 所以授权失败; 解决方式 自建用户分配读写权限,否则无法注册到nacos的命名空间中 wzkriscommentedOct 16, 2024 tb-bearclosed this ascompletedOct 16, 2024
可以设置角色对应的命名空间(页面上名称为资源), 在动作下拉框中指定读写权限(只读\只写\读写). 一个角色可以配置多个权限. 合理的使用namespace和group来隔离配置文件, 再辅以用户的角色、权限控制, 组合的权限策略还是比较灵活的, 应该能满足大多数项目的安全需求. 创建好用户后可以通过curl命令验证一下效果. cu...
在application.properties配置文件中有如下配置,可以配置权限相关的内容,可以看到在1.2.0的版本中,已经作废了spring.security.enabled的相关配置,使用新的权限配置,只需要配置nacos.core.auth.enabled=true,即可开启nacos的权限功能,在管理界面中配置好相应的命名空间,用户、角色、权限等,万事俱备。
Nacos 引入命名空间 Namespace 的概念来进行多环境配置和服务的管理及隔离。 例如,你可能存在本地开发环境dev、测试环境test、生产环境prod 三个不同的环境,那么可以创建三个不同的 Namespace 区分不同的环境。 成功创建新命名空间后,就可以在 springboot 的配置文件配置命名空间的 id 切换到对应的命名空间,并获取...
用创建的新用户登陆控制台,访问相应的命名空间, 确认是否用访问权限; 提供一个可以复现此问题的demo项目; Collaborator KomachiSion commented Feb 24, 2023 是不是只创建了角色,权限,没做关联。 KomachiSion added the status/need feedback label Feb 24, 2023 Louis2014 commented Mar 1, 2023 I also had...
命名空间概述 命名空间概述命名空间(Namespace)是对一组资源和对象的抽象整合。在同一个CCE集群内可创建不同的命名空间,不同命名空间中的数据彼此隔离。使得它们既可以共享同一个集群的服务,也能够互不干扰。例如可以将开发环境、测试环境的业务分别放在不同的命名空间。命名空间的类别说明,如表1所示。
MSE Nacos注册中心能够按照实例、命名空间、Group、ServiceName设置访问权限,降低某个实例被恶意用户非法获取、修改的风险。本文介绍如何在MSE上为Nacos注册中心配置细粒度鉴权。 阿里云文档 2024-09-03 为Nacos实例开启鉴权实现访问控制 MSE中的Nacos注册配置中心可以开启鉴权功能,以降低某个实例被恶意用户非法获取或...